Rain Chain Water Features

rain chain water features

Rain chain water features are a unique alternative to traditional downspouts, guiding rainwater from the roof to the ground in a decorative and musical manner, creating a soothing sound as the water flows down the chain, adding visual and auditory interest to a garden or yard.

Disappearing Fountains for Small Spaces

water features for yards

Disappearing fountains are ideal for small spaces, as they don’t take up a lot of room. The fountain basin is typically hidden from view, creating a sleek and modern appearance. Water flows from a central feature, such as a statue or sphere, and disappears into the ground, making them perfect for compact gardens and courtyards.

Backyard Pond Maintenance Tips

keep water clean regularly

Proper backyard pond maintenance is vital for a healthy ecosystem. Regularly test water quality, remove debris, and maintain adequate filtration to prevent algae growth. Additionally, guarantee proper aeration and circulation to keep water fresh and clean, creating a thriving environment for plants and aquatic life to flourish.

Pondless Waterfalls for Gardens

water features without ponds

Pondless waterfalls are a unique feature in garden design, creating a serene and peaceful atmosphere without the need for a pond. Water flows from a raised area, cascading down rocks or other materials, disappearing into a hidden reservoir, and recirculating back to the top, producing a soothing sound and visual effect.
